Seminal quality in chronic hemodialysis patients is linked to seminal transferrin levels, not seminal ferritin. This finding aids in evaluating potential subfertility in these patients.

Area of Science:

  • Nephrology
  • Reproductive Medicine
  • Clinical Biochemistry

Background:

  • Chronic hemodialysis (CH) patients may experience altered seminal quality.
  • Investigating the relationship between seminal parameters and specific proteins like ferritin and transferrin is crucial.

Purpose of the Study:

  • To explore the association between seminal quality and seminal levels of ferritin and transferrin in men undergoing chronic hemodialysis.
  • To determine if seminal ferritin or transferrin levels are indicative of subfertility in CH patients.

Main Methods:

  • A cross-sectional study comparing 60 men on CH with 30 healthy controls (age 18-60).
  • Semen analysis (spermogram) and measurement of seminal ferritin and transferrin levels were performed.
  • Participants were screened for infection/inflammation and eugonadism.

Main Results:

  • Men undergoing CH showed significantly lower seminal parameters and seminal transferrin levels compared to controls.
  • Seminal ferritin levels were similar between CH patients and controls.
  • Seminal transferrin levels, but not seminal ferritin, were significantly associated with seminal parameters (p<0.001).

Conclusions:

  • Seminal quality in chronic hemodialysis patients is associated with seminal transferrin levels.
  • Seminal ferritin levels do not appear to be related to seminal quality in this cohort.
  • Measuring seminal transferrin may be useful for initial evaluation of subfertility in CH patients.
